4 / 46 page 4 ______________________________________________________________________________________ Single-Port, 40W, IEEE 802.3af/at, PSE Controller with I2C ELECTRICAL CHARACTERISTICS (continued) (VAGND - VEE = 32V to 60V, TA = -40NC to +85NC, all voltages are referenced to VEE, unless otherwise noted. Typical values are at VAGND - VEE = +54V, TA = +25NC. Currents are positive when entering the pin and negative otherwise.) (Note 2) PARAMETER SYMBOL CONDITIONS MIN TYP MAX UNITS LOAD DISCONNECT DC Load-Disconnect Threshold IDCTH Minimum load current allowed before disconnect (DC disconnect active), VOUT = 0V 5 7.5 10 mA AC Load-Disconnect Threshold (Note 4) IACTH Current into DET, for IDET < IACTH the port powers off (AC disconnect active) 115 130 145 F A Triangular Wave Peak-to-Peak Voltage Amplitude AMPTRW Measured at DET, referred to AGND 3.85 4 4.2 V OSC Pullup/Pulldown Currents IOSC Measured at OSC 26 32 39 F A ACD_EN Threshold VACD_EN VOSC - VEE > VACD_EN to activate AC disconnect 270 330 380 mV Load-Disconnect Timer tDISC Time from IRSENSE < IDCTH (DC disconnect active) or IDET < IACTH (AC disconnect active) to gate shutdown (Note 5) 300 400 ms DETECTION Detection Probe Voltage (First Phase) VDPH1 VAGND - VDET during the first detection phase 3.8 4 4.2 V Detection Probe Voltage (Second Phase) VDPH2 VAGND - VDET during the second detection phase 9 9.3 9.6 V Current-Limit Protection IDLIM VDET = VAGND during detection, measure current through DET 1.50 1.75 2.00 mA Short-Circuit Threshold VDCP If VAGND - VOUT < VDCP after the first detection phase a short circuit to AGND is detected. 1 V Open-Circuit Threshold ID_OPEN First point measurement current threshold for open condition 20 F A Resistor Detection Window RDOK (Note 6) 19 26.5 kI Resistor Rejection Window RDBAD Detection rejects lower values 15.5 kI Detection rejects higher values 32 CLASSIFICATION Classification Probe Voltage VCL VAGND - VDET during classification 16 20 V Current-Limit Protection IClLIM VDET = VAGND, during classification measure current through DET 65 80 mA |
